What is the density of Iodine gas at 2.36 atm and 65.0 C?

The density : 21.63 g/L

Further explanation

The gas equation can be written


\large {\boxed {\bold {PV = nRT}}}

where

P = pressure, atm

V = volume, liter

n = number of moles

R = gas constant = 0.08206 L.atm / mol K

T = temperature, Kelvin

T = 65+273=338 K

P=2.36 atm

MW Iodine gas (I₂)=254

The density :


\tt \rho=(P* MW)/(RT)\\\\\rho=(2.36* 254)/(0.082* 338)=21.63~g/L
